A sub-processor is a third party that processes personal data on our behalf to deliver part of the GradeOrbit service. We list every sub-processor we use, their role, and their jurisdiction below. This page is the authoritative source — we update it whenever the list changes.

Under our Data Processing Agreement, which forms part of our Terms, schools are entitled to advance notice of any change to this list and may object before the change takes effect. A school’s Data Protection Officer can review the Data Processing Agreement at any time.

Supabase

Authentication, primary database, file storage

Jurisdiction
EU (Frankfurt) — operated by Supabase Inc., US
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s
Data accessed
Account email and hashed credentials for teacher, school-staff, learner and (school tier) pupil logins; application records (assessments, criteria, credit balances). For schools on a DPA, also un-redacted student work, real student names and marking / AI-detection results, stored in private buckets under the school’s retention window. Learner-account work is also stored, unredacted, under the learner’s own consent, until the learner deletes their account. Solo and Team student work is redacted client-side and is not stored.

Google Gemini

AI marking, AI detection, transcription, suggested improvements

Jurisdiction
US — Google LLC
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s, no-training contractual stance
Data accessed
Solo tier: redacted student work pages (PII burnt out client-side), mark schemes, reference texts. School tier: unredacted student work pages under DPA, persisted in our storage for the active life of the assessment run only (default 90 days from completion, then deleted). Learner tier: unredacted work pages saved under the learner’s own account, until the learner deletes it. Inputs are not used to train Google’s foundation models under their no-training contractual stance. Per-school fine-tuning of a tenanted marking agent (school tier only) is documented in the Transparency Pack.

Google Cloud Vision

OCR for mark scheme and reference text uploads

Jurisdiction
US — Google LLC
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s
Data accessed
Mark scheme documents and reference text images uploaded by teachers. No student work is sent to Vision.

Resend

Transactional and product email delivery

Jurisdiction
US — Resend Inc.
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s
Data accessed
Recipient email address and message content (e.g. invites, receipts, account notifications). For schools that give pupils logins, this includes pupil email addresses, used only to send two transactional messages — a set-password link and a “your result is ready” notification. Grades and feedback are never included in email content.

Stripe

Payment processing for credit purchases and subscriptions

Jurisdiction
US / Ireland — Stripe Payments Europe Ltd.
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s (Stripe acts as an independent controller for payment data)
Data accessed
Billing email, billing address, payment instrument metadata. Card numbers never touch GradeOrbit servers.

Sentry

Error monitoring and crash reporting

Jurisdiction
US — Functional Software, Inc.
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s
Data accessed
Stack traces, browser metadata, anonymised user IDs on opt-in feedback only. Default PII is disabled; session replay is not enabled.

Vercel

Application hosting, edge runtime, cron, geo-IP

Jurisdiction
US — Vercel Inc.
Transfer mechanism
UK IDTA + EU SCCs
Data accessed
HTTP request metadata (IP, user agent, country code) needed to serve the application and enforce UK-only access.

What we do not use

We do not use third-party advertising networks or behavioural analytics platforms beyond what is disclosed below. Optional analytics, session-recording, and marketing tools (Google Analytics 4, Hotjar, Meta Pixel) are disclosed in our Cookie Policy and only run after explicit consent. Marketing tools never track student-role accounts.
